I uncovered these Dr. Scholl’s x Free People sandals about a month ago. Since then, I kept them on my radar for a sale or promotion. Both colorways (peep either link for the denim-ish version) are on what seems to be permanent markdown via Free People; however, the size selection is – rightfully – picked over.
I ordered the eyelet version in a size ten. This was an optimistic move on my part as I was last a safe and solid size ten pre-first baby. Nevertheless, as it was sold out in a size eleven, I gave the ten a shot. Unfortunately, not only do these sandals not fit but they run especially small. Keep that in mind when ordering.
I waiting a few weeks for the sandals to go on a similar promotion via the Dr. Scholl’s site because the shoes are just that adorable in person. I love the brassy hardware, specifically the three starburst-shaped grommets on either side of the sandal, fastening the fabric to the wood sole.
